메소드 | 설명 | |
---|---|---|
createSignature ( QueryAuth\Request\RequestInterface $request, QueryAuth\Credentials\CredentialsInterface $credentials ) | Creates signature |
메소드 | 설명 | |
---|---|---|
getAbsolutePath ( string $path ) : string | Ensures that path is absolute | |
normalizeParameters ( array $params ) : string | Normalizes request parameters |
public createSignature ( QueryAuth\Request\RequestInterface $request, QueryAuth\Credentials\CredentialsInterface $credentials ) | ||
$request | QueryAuth\Request\RequestInterface | |
$credentials | QueryAuth\Credentials\CredentialsInterface |
protected getAbsolutePath ( string $path ) : string | ||
$path | string | Request path |
리턴 | string | Absolute request path |
protected normalizeParameters ( array $params ) : string | ||
$params | array | Request parameters |
리턴 | string | Normalized, rawurlencoded parameter string |